Have you ever read a fic you enjoyed and thought, "That was awesome! But if I'd done it, I would have told it from another character's POV/made it darker than it was/set it in another country/etc"? Well, now [livejournal.com profile] cm_remix gives you a chance to do just that!

[livejournal.com profile] cm_remix is a Criminal Minds Fanfic Remix Challenge that will be starting to take sign ups soon!

If you've written at least three 1,000 word (minimum) fics in the Criminal Minds fandom, you can sign up to have your fics remixed! You'll be matched up with another author whose fic you will then rewrite! Sign ups start on Valentine's Day, assignments are sent out by the end of the month, and you will have three months to complete your remix.

For more information on [livejournal.com profile] cm_remix, please see the complete rules, information, and important dates HERE. We hope you'll come join the fun!

As in two one shots and a series? I hadn't considered that, but I just added these notes to the rules:

You may offer a series/WIP, even if it's unfinished, provided you don't mind the possibility of someone else finishing your story in their own way (as each submitted fic must be a completed one-shot.) An offered series/chaptered wip counts as ONE submission, though remixers may chose to remix/expand upon only one part.

and


If your assigned suthor has listed a series/wip (completed or not), you may choose to remix all of it, or an individual chapter, so long as the fic you submit is a complete, stand alone one shot. e.g. you may remix and an unfinished series and add your own ending, remix one chapter and expand it into a stand alone fic, etc.

Each finished remix must be a complete, stand alone one shot, and it may not be part of a series you are already working on, or a universe you have already created.
